Transaction 5866121944ea99cd2622ae296e758524565472244afbe4df0205e5aa5cfd63fc

3 Input
2 Outputs
  • 5866121944ea99cd2622ae296e758524565472244afbe4df0205e5aa5cfd63fc:0
  • value  1278182
    address  1LVcANhmrbmA8nvBquuVAzLi6JdXjErrPv
  • 5866121944ea99cd2622ae296e758524565472244afbe4df0205e5aa5cfd63fc:1
  • value  12542023
    address  38psGxR9Cb2R6x7vF4DT8xRWYba1B9Uh6k